Commerce has amended the preliminary determination in the antidumping duty investigation on ferrosilicon from Malaysia.
This amendment was published on 12/11/2024 in the Federal Register (89 FR 99829) and changes the cash deposit rate for certain producers and/or exporters.
2.
The products covered by this investigation are described in message 4313406, dated 11/08/2024.
3.
This proceeding has been assigned case number A-557-828.
4.
For shipments of ferrosilicon from Malaysia entered, or withdrawn from warehouse, for consumption on or after 12/11/2024, CBP shall require, for such entries, a cash deposit equal to the margins for the producers and/or exporters listed below:
Producer and/or Exporter: OM Sarawak Sdn. Bhd
Case number: A-557-828-001
Cash deposit rate: 18.80 %
Producer and/or Exporter: Pertama Ferroalloys Sdn. Bhd
Case number: A-557-828-002
Cash deposit rate: 37.91 %
All Others
Case Number: A-557-828-000
Cash Deposit Rate: 27.17 %
